The FPO75-B100C4D8PE2M is a 75W distributed power supply designed for access control and security door systems. It delivers simultaneous dual-voltage output — 2A at 12V and 2A at 24V — from a single enclosure, eliminating the need for separate power units at each lock and auxiliary device. The E2M form factor (20H × 16W × 4.5D inches) fits standard cabinet and wall-mount installations where space is tight but output density matters.
This supply is built for Mercury-series 4-door access control systems and compatible with any Class 2 solenoid locks, electronic latches, and auxiliary loads (relay modules, door sensors, exit devices) rated for 12V or 24V operation. The four dedicated lock outputs and eight auxiliary outputs support typical multi-door installations with integrated alarm and monitoring circuits. Confirm your lock and sensor voltage requirements before installation — the dual rails run independently, so you can assign 12V devices to one output set and 24V to the other, or mix them within power-budget constraints.
Mount the enclosure in a secure location (equipment room, closet, wall-mounted panel) with adequate airflow to keep the power supply within safe operating temperature. Verify total load on each rail does not exceed 2A per voltage output — exceeding this will trigger overcurrent protection and shutdown. Run separate Class 2 wiring from each output rail to locks and auxiliary devices; do not daisy-chain outputs without intermediate distribution blocks if load is heavy. Wire input power (primary AC supply) per local electrical code and access control standards.
